John Schneider and the Toronto Blue Jays have expressed immense satisfaction following their performance in Game 4 of the World Series. In a marathon match that tied the record for the longest game in the event’s history, stretching over 18 innings, the Blue Jays demonstrated resilience and signaled their determination not to back down against the Los Angeles Dodgers.
During the game, manager Schneider identified a pivotal moment that secured the Blue Jays’ victory, leveling the series at 2-2. “Vladdy’s swing was monumental,” Schneider stated. “A sweeper aims to force pop-ups, in my opinion, and Vlad’s swing was of the highest caliber.”
Schneider continued: “Given all the accolades surrounding Shohei Ohtani, with him on the mound today, Vlad’s swing was crucial. It sparked our momentum.
